Global Market: China eyes faster national infrastructure spending to steady growth amid local investment slump

China is accelerating national infrastructure projects to boost economic growth this year. This strategy aims to offset reduced local government investment and tighten spending oversight. Beijing plans significant spending on various infrastructure upgrades and high-tech industries. Local governments face debt constraints, limiting their investment capacity and borrowing. Global Market: CXMT’s $8.6 billion IPO draws strong retail demand, but investor caution persists

Chinese memory chipmaker CXMT’s IPO attracted strong retail investor interest. The retail tranche was oversubscribed by 243.93 times, showing robust demand. This oversubscription level was lower than recent Chinese listings, reflecting investor caution. Tech shares have faced volatility amid concerns over valuations and market liquidity.
